Case Transportation LLC is applying for government grants to enhance its service capabilities during the upcoming fire season. The requested funding will be allocated to purchase a handwashing unit that will be used continuously for firefighters, utilizing a 12-volt system to ensure efficiency without relying on a generator.
The business plan involves using generated revenue from this fire season to acquire at least three additional trailers, allowing the company to serve more firefighters in future contracts.
As a veteran with a service-connected disability and six years of experience in the industry, the applicant has a strong track record, having never received negative feedback from previous employers.
In terms of competition, Case Transportation faces strong players like Alpine Transport and Evergreen. However, the applicant has consistently underbid their prices, securing more contracts over the past two years. Relationships with these companies have also been beneficial for gaining industry knowledge and insights.
The company's competitive edge lies in its year-round service model, leveraging the handwashing trailers beyond the firefighting season. By maintaining operations during the winter months at events like rodeos and carnivals, the business aims to avoid the seasonal downtime that affects many competitors. The applicant has invested in building robust trailers designed to operate in cold weather, positioning the company for sustained revenue generation throughout the year.

Self Identified Competition
Alpine transport is one of the more prominent competitors located in my region I worked for them initially when I first started out and have planned to modify my trailers to work better than theirs. My contract these past two years have beaten their prices and have resulted in more time on fires than any single one of theirs. Wildfire mobile laundry is another company I worked for he has helped me get my foot in the door showing me how to set up my own business as well as letting me build contracts based on what his look like after 20+ years in the industry. He has helped me get my foot in the door utilizing one of his trailers splitting the profits 50/50 with me of the trailer. Evergreen is another company who runs contracts for wildland fire camps and I have beaten their prices two years in a row. My company is new but I have worked on different variations of hand wash units learning what works and doesn’t. A lot of companies are worried solely about getting the contract for the fires and when the season ends they don’t look for other avenues of revenue for that mobile sink trailer. I will be making my trailers available year round meaning in the spring, summer, and fall months I’ll be on fires but in the winter I’ll be able to find work at winter rodeo series, winter carnivals, concerts, and many other events. A lot of individuals winterize their equipment in the fall where I will be building mine to withstand the cold and in turn I’ll be able to work through the winter months with no worry of freezing pipes or pumps.
